alarm goes off when I use the key ?
 
Hey guys not sure if this is the correct thread to post in but its an aftermarket part. The guys I bought it off had installed a viper remote starter/alarm. The only way I can open it is using the remote to lock/unlock but today my battery in the remote died and I had to use the key. I unlocked it but the alarm went off and I put the key in the ignition and it still kept going off, I also tried cranking but nothing. So I had to walk my *** a few miles to go home and get the other remote :( I was pissed !

Anyway any ideas on how to fix that or maybe even disable the alarm all the way just leave the remote starter to work. This alarm also goes off at random times at night sometimes, like wtf??

OnlyInMyXJ22 03-14-2012 07:28 PM

The alarm going off when using the key is done be design I believe. My dad had a Viper system on his Benz that would do that if you used the key after locking with remote. The rest I'm not sure.

xjpettit99 03-14-2012 08:25 PM

All after market alarms I have found do that it always drives me crazy. I have not found a way around this yet other than locking the door with the key, but then the alarm is not active.
